Analysis

In 2017, government expenditure on pre-primary education, us$ in Luxembourg stood at 307.43 millions.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 6.5% on the previous year and up 17.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, government expenditure on pre-primary education, us$ in Luxembourg peaked at 437.92 millions in 2011 and was at its lowest, 0 millions, in 1970.

Luxembourg ranks 53rd of 158 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Total general (local, regional and central) government expenditure on pre-primary education (current, capital, and transfers) in millions US$ (nominal value). It includes expenditure funded by transfers from international sources to government. Total government expenditure for a given level of education (e.g. primary, secondary, or all levels combined) in national currency is converted to US$. Limitations: In some instances data on total government expenditure on education refers only to the Ministry of Education, excluding other ministries which may also spend a part of their budget on educational activities.
